Frederik Carlier
92e4e3fafe
Add Rocky Linux build leg
2024-04-29 17:36:07 +02:00
Frederik Carlier
924960a613
Add CI leg using MinGW64 + libobjc2 + clang
2024-02-21 08:45:58 +01:00
Frederik Seiffert
e13195b44e
CI: various improvements
...
- update GitHub actions (fixes Node.js 12 deprecation warnings)
- separate Linux and Windows jobs
- add option to specify tools-make branch for manual run
- Windows MSVC: use dependencies from pre-built release (with option to build dependencies via manual run)
- Windows MSVC: set GitHub token when building dependencies to prevent GitHub rate limit errors
- remove installation of libkqueue-dev package (not used by libdispatch)
- update dependencies from libobjc-9-dev to libobjc-10-dev
- add -q flag to git clone to prevent progress logs from spamming logs
2023-01-06 15:56:28 -06:00
Frederik Seiffert
9a5c5dc35c
CI: add Windows MSVC builds
2021-08-08 17:27:40 +02:00
Frederik Seiffert
2f953651a8
CI: add test matrix
2021-07-20 19:54:48 +02:00
Fred Kiefer
070c533f6a
Add call to GNUstep.sh
2021-07-13 13:28:48 +02:00
Fred Kiefer
f37d9278bc
Correct test.sh use of echo
2021-07-13 13:19:25 +02:00
Fred Kiefer
ded820f7be
Make test.sh executable
2021-07-13 13:11:18 +02:00
Gregory Casamento
354ae5c259
Move tests to separate script
2021-07-13 02:59:24 -04:00
Gregory Casamento
5b96c7450e
remove redundant script
2021-07-12 12:12:26 -04:00
Gregory Casamento
369e0c8dda
Reinstate tests
2021-07-12 11:07:01 -04:00
Gregory Casamento
19ef0056e9
Update build.sh
2021-07-12 10:29:19 -04:00
Gregory Casamento
918c3c0a1c
Update build.sh
2021-07-12 10:28:27 -04:00
Gregory Casamento
b70d843eb4
Disable testing for now.
2021-07-11 15:47:55 -04:00
Gregory John Casamento
3241053a32
Fix TLS and CURL issues.
2021-07-11 10:52:11 -04:00
Gregory John Casamento
90e824ca81
Fix TLS and CURL issues.
2021-07-11 10:50:00 -04:00
Gregory John Casamento
e002a2d1ef
Build base and test
2021-07-11 09:42:30 -04:00
Gregory John Casamento
d4b38f618e
Fix OS detection
2021-07-11 08:45:42 -04:00
Gregory John Casamento
35776a972a
Fix libobjc install
2021-07-11 06:27:05 -04:00
Gregory John Casamento
fdb7e88a9a
Add dependencies script
2021-07-11 06:16:05 -04:00
Gregory John Casamento
44e5b5f45e
Add env vars and bring scripts over
2021-07-11 05:45:07 -04:00
Gregory John Casamento
8457cfdd8a
Add env vars and bring scripts over
2021-07-11 05:41:38 -04:00
Gregory John Casamento
b2a8de618f
add scripts
2021-07-10 15:37:50 -04:00